Amazon UK lists “Bethesda E3 2014 Dummy” game despite the publisher saying they won’t announce a thing

Despite Bethesda head Pete Hines saying his company “will not be talking about its next game for a long time”, Amazon UK briefly listed a new product nicknamed “Bethesda E3 2014 Dummy”.

The listing, of course, has since been removed… but not before Videogamer managed to grab a screenshot.

dummybethesda_e3

It’s believed the listing was a placeholder, meant to be finalised and put on public display after an E3 announcement.

The listing was for a title on PS3, PS4, PC, Wii, Xbox 360, Xbox One, Nintendo 3DS and PlayStation Vita and had a 2014 release date.
